1. Understanding the Light-Year: A Cosmic Unit of Measurement

The light-year is a unit of distance, not time, representing the distance light travels in one Earth year. Since the universe is so vast, measuring distances in miles or kilometers becomes impractical. A light-year provides a more manageable scale for expressing these immense distances. According to NASA, one light-year is equivalent to approximately 5.88 trillion miles (9.46 trillion kilometers). This measurement is crucial for understanding the scale of our galaxy and the universe beyond.

To put this into perspective, consider these relatable terms:

  • Lightsecond: Approximately 300,000 kilometers (186,000 miles).
  • Lightminute: About 18 million kilometers (11 million miles).
  • Lighthour: Around 1.1 billion kilometers.

Understanding these units helps appreciate the vastness of space and the challenges involved in interstellar travel.

2. Current Spacecraft Speeds and Light-Year Travel Time

Our current spacecraft technology is nowhere near capable of traveling at the speed of light. Even the fastest spacecraft would take thousands of years to cover just one light-year. Let’s break down the travel times based on different speeds:

Speed Time to Travel One Light-Year
Apollo Spacecraft (39,400 km/h) ~27,000 years
Commercial Airplane (965 km/h) ~1 million years
Average Car (90 km/h) ~12 million years
Walking Speed (5 km/h) ~216 million years
Earth’s Orbit Speed (107,000 km/h) ~10,000 years
Solar System Speed (720,000 km/h) ~1,500 years

As you can see, even at the speeds our Solar System travels through the Galaxy, traveling a single light-year is an incredibly lengthy endeavor.

3. The Closest Star: Proxima Centauri

Proxima Centauri, the closest star to our Sun, is approximately 4.25 light-years away. This means that light from Proxima Centauri takes 4.25 years to reach Earth. If we were to travel to Proxima Centauri using current spacecraft technology, it would take tens of thousands of years. This immense travel time underscores the challenges of interstellar travel and the need for advanced propulsion systems. According to the European Space Agency (ESA), future missions may aim to reach a fraction of the speed of light, which could drastically reduce travel times.

4. Theoretical Faster-Than-Light Travel Methods

Faster-than-light (FTL) travel remains largely theoretical, but scientists have proposed several concepts that could potentially make interstellar travel more feasible in the future. Some of these include:

  • Wormholes: Hypothetical tunnels through spacetime that could connect two distant points in the universe. However, the existence and stability of wormholes are unproven.
  • Warp Drives: A theoretical propulsion system that would warp spacetime around a spacecraft, allowing it to travel faster than light without violating the laws of physics. This concept was popularized by science fiction, but physicists are exploring its potential feasibility.
  • Quantum Entanglement: While not a means of transportation itself, quantum entanglement could potentially allow for instantaneous communication over vast distances, which could be useful for controlling spacecraft remotely.

These concepts are highly speculative, and significant technological breakthroughs would be needed to make them a reality.

5. The Challenges of Interstellar Travel

Traveling even a single light-year poses immense challenges, including:

  • Distance: The sheer distance involved requires spacecraft to travel for decades or even centuries.
  • Speed: Achieving speeds close to the speed of light requires enormous amounts of energy and advanced propulsion systems.
  • Radiation: Space is filled with harmful radiation that can damage spacecraft and endanger astronauts.
  • Navigation: Navigating accurately over interstellar distances requires precise instruments and a deep understanding of astrophysics.
  • Resources: Sustaining a crew for decades requires carrying vast amounts of food, water, and other essential resources.

Overcoming these challenges requires significant advancements in science and technology, as noted by a report from the National Research Council.

6. Project Starshot: A Glimmer of Hope for the Future

Project Starshot, an initiative backed by physicist Stephen Hawking and entrepreneur Yuri Milner, aims to send tiny, laser-propelled spacecraft to Proxima Centauri. The concept involves using a powerful array of lasers to accelerate these “starchips” to 20% of the speed of light. At this speed, they could reach Proxima Centauri in just over 20 years.

8. Light-Years and Looking Back in Time

When we observe objects that are millions or billions of light-years away, we are seeing them as they existed millions or billions of years ago. The light from these objects has taken that long to reach us, so we are essentially looking back in time. For example, the galaxy NGC 1097 is 45 million light-years from Earth, meaning we see it as it existed 45 million years ago. This ability to look back in time is one of the most fascinating aspects of astronomy and allows us to study the evolution of the universe.

9. Implications for Interstellar Colonization

The vast distances between stars pose a significant challenge to interstellar colonization. Even if we could travel at a fraction of the speed of light, it would still take generations to reach even the closest star systems. This raises questions about the feasibility of interstellar colonization and the ethical considerations of sending humans on such long journeys.

Some researchers have proposed the idea of generation ships, which are spacecraft designed to sustain multiple generations of humans during interstellar voyages. However, the challenges of building and maintaining such ships are immense.
